China on Tuesday hit back at US sanctions against one of its largest telecommunications equipment makers, saying the measures would “severely affect” Chinese companies.
ZTE, China’s second-largest global supplier of telecoms switches, routers and cables after Huawei, faces being cut off from its US technology suppliers after the US commerce department found it had illicitly sold US technology to Iran in contravention of US law, including via shell companies.
Any US company seeking to sell to ZTE must have a licence issued by the department, it said.
